Document Drying Services Cost in Beggs, OK

The cost of Document Drying Services in Beggs, OK can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. These estimates are based on our experience and may vary depending on your specific situation. We’ll provide you with a free estimate and work with your insurance company to ensure a smooth claims process.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Minor Document Drying (small area, minor damage) $200-$1,000 Severity and size of damage
Major Document Drying (extensive damage, multiple areas) $1,000-$5,000 Severity and size of damage, equipment and labor costs
Mold Removal (visible signs of mold or mildew) $500-$2,000 Severity and extent of mold growth
Humidity and Moisture Correction (unusual humidity or moisture levels) $300-$1,500 Severity and extent of humidity and moisture issues
Document Restoration (discoloration or warping of documents) $500-$2,000 Severity and extent of damage to documents
Emergency Document Drying (water damage on walls or floors) $1,000-$5,000 Severity and size of damage, equipment and labor costs

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ment. We offer free estimates and work with your insurance company to ensure a smooth claims process.
